Transaction d2d90776590a233162a2340b866efe60c671deb1a28db16bc0b29ad96704ce94
1 Input
1 Output
-
d2d90776590a233162a2340b866efe60c671deb1a28db16bc0b29ad96704ce94:0
- value
- 96358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e58f43e1c61a023b79d6897d3c030b1f918ac011 OP_EQUAL
- address
- 3NcpHiC669riujxc2ySVPnbSJRz31mh5wk